php如何用gbk编码的系列问题

这里我用editplus来举例吧。我新建了一个php文档。内容如下<html><head><metahttp-equiv="Content-Type"content="t... 这里我用editplus来举例吧。
我新建了一个php文档。内容如下

<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=GBK" />
</head>
<body>
<?php
$name = '';
$name = '百毒贴吧';

echo $name;
?>
</body>
</html>

用ansi编码保存,预览,结果显示是乱码:�ٶ����� ,FIREFOX下也是如此,如果在IE里手动选择为“简体中文GB2312”,就可以正常显示,但是关闭重新预览又是乱码,就是每次都需要手动选择编码观察,这显示不是我想要的结果。请问怎么解决这个问题?
<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
这样也不行。反正每访问一页,就需要手动选择一下编码。

另外请问,我用EDITPLUS编程保存文件时没有GBK这种是什么原因,点了旁边“...”也没有在列表中找到gbk.
展开
 我来答
lpicjj
2008-07-25 · 超过18用户采纳过TA的回答
知道答主
回答量:61
采纳率:0%
帮助的人:27.4万
展开全部
那你安装时PHP的设置没有设为缺省的是GBK,
你可以在php.ini中修改
将default_charset= 改为gb2312或是gbk就可,当然像正如三楼说的在
最前面添加(必须最前面,包含不能有空行和任何字符):
<?php
header('Content-Type: text/html; charset=gb2312');
?>
也是可以的
wzz0zed
2008-07-25
知道答主
回答量:18
采纳率:0%
帮助的人:0
展开全部
1.页面编码声明用gbk
<meta http-equiv="Content-Type" content="text/html; charset=gbk" />
2,页面保存用gbk保存,推荐用editplus.

补充:
一般文件保存(文本文件),在保存的时候按系统默认语言编码(字符集ANSI)保存, 在中文系统上是gbk,英文系统上是iso8859_1, 日文系统上是ms932.

建议使用utf-8编码
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
任梦坷
2015-11-05
知道答主
回答量:25
采纳率:0%
帮助的人:3.7万
展开全部
<meta charset="gbk"/>
一、编码范围
1. GBK (GB2312/GB18030)
x00-xff GBK双字节编码范围
x20-x7f ASCII
xa1-xff 中文
x80-xff 中文
2. UTF-8 (Unicode)
u4e00-u9fa5 (中文)
x3130-x318F (韩文
xAC00-xD7A3 (韩文)
u0800-u4e00 (日文)
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
阳光上的桥
2008-07-24 · 知道合伙人软件行家
阳光上的桥
知道合伙人软件行家
采纳数:21424 获赞数:65795
网盘是个好东东,可以对话和传文件

向TA提问 私信TA
展开全部
最前面添加(必须最前面,包含不能有空行和任何字符):
<?php
header('Content-Type: text/html; charset=gb2312');
?>
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
rickysilk
2008-07-24 · TA获得超过691个赞
知道小有建树答主
回答量:509
采纳率:0%
帮助的人:530万
展开全部
<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/>

试一下这样吧.
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(3)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式